#559d80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#559d80 is composed of 33.3% red, 61.6%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.5%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 155.8 degrees, a saturation of 29.8% and a lightness of 47.5%. #559d80 color hex could be obtained by blending #aaffff with #003b01.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#559d80 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#559d80 has RGB values of R:85, G:157,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.18,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 5610880.
